7.2.1 Install the motor on pumps supplied without motor

1. Remove the coupling guards (681) and the coupling shells (862).
2. Remove the seal protection bracket (89-11.03) and its mounting material. For pumps with a taper piece
(722), with motor of 5.5 kW or higher, the two bolts (914.02 or 901.02) have to be placed back to connect
the taper piece to the motor stool. Thoroughly clean the motor stool (341), the shaft (210), the coupling
shells (862) and the motor shaft.
3. Loosely fasten the coupling shells (862) with the coupling pin (560) on the shaft (210). Use the hexagon
socket head cap screw (914.01) and the nut (920.01) for this. When the pump is equipped with a steel
coupling, never use the same coupling twice but order a new one.
4. Place the motor on the motor stool (341).
5. Pump with cartridge seal:
Loosen the three cartridge grub screws (904) one turn.
Push the hydraulic pump assembly in the lowest position.
Tighten the three cartridge grub screws (904) rmly to the shaft.
6. Tighten the lower bolts of the coupling shells (862) in such a way that the coupling slightly clamps around
the motor shaft.
7. For pump series VMS: use a su󰀩cient tyre iron to lift the coupling (and hydraulic assembly) 1.5 mm
higher then the lowest position. For easy and accurate adjustment of the coupling contact your supplier for
the appropriate toolkit for hydraulics adjustment.
